I've read all about "installing applications as admin" and I've read about Runas, Sanur, CPAU, and the likes. I understand how to call antother application, such as an exe ot bat file, but what about calling another script alltogether?

Is it OK to just call kix32 (as another user) from my main kix32 login script?

Hmm...

You cannot "CALL" it as another user, but you can SHELL or RUN a run-as type command which will execute a new instance of KiXtart.

You need to be careful however because your environment may change, for example you may not have access to the drive mappings or even current working directory that you had in your "parent" script.

You also won't have access to any variables declared in your parent script - this will be a new and completely independant invocation of KiXtart.
